CALDERON, Margeris Yanes  e  CHIO NARANJO, Ileana. Climacteric and sexuality: their repercussion on the quality of life of the middle-aged females. Rev Cubana Med Gen Integr [online]. 2008, vol.24, n.2, pp. 0-0. ISSN 1561-3038.

In order to describe the behavior of sexuality and analyze its repercussion on the quality of life of climacteric females, a descriptive cross-sectional study was conducted among 142 females aged 40-59. 78 of them were in the perimenopausal period and 64 in the postmenopausal period. All of them were from 2 family physicians' offices of "Ana Betancourt" Teaching Polyclinic in Playa municipality, Havana City. Some of the main results that characterized the partner relation during the postmenopausal period were the little help of the partner, irritability, misunderstanding, incomprehension and the frequent arguments, which were present in more than 35 % of this group of females. The alterations of the sexual sphere, such as vaginal dryness, decrease of the sexual desire and pain on penetration were observed in more than 30 % of the postmenopausal females, and just in 15 % of the perimenopausal females. The sociocultural factors placed a determinant role in the results attained.
